Summary
An account of the survival of a twenty-eight man crew whose ship for a 1914 expedition to Antarctica was marooned in pack ice. Explains the daily difficulties the men faced during their nine-month ordeal and Captain Ernest Shackleton's bravery to effect their rescue. For grades 5-8
